    Want to start a skateboard shop, should i get an LLC?

    I have never owned a business before. I was wondering what are all the steps I need to take to start a retail shop. And in what order do I need to take the steps? Do I get a EIN first? Or file for LLC? Do I really need an LLC?
    Any input would be greatly appreciated, thank you.

    I would file an LLC. They are usually pretty inexpensive and protect you from being personally liable for anything that may happen, unless you are proved to be negligent in preventing an accident etc... (piercing the corporate veil).

    Yes, you should always get an L.L.C. or some type of business entity to protect yourself. What state are you in? You can probably do the paperwork yourself for a couple hundred bucks in lieu of hiring an attorney who will charge you a pretty penny
